#ba1131 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ba1131 is composed of 72.9% red, 6.7%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90.9% magenta, 73.7%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 348.6 degrees, a saturation of 83.3% and a lightness of 39.8%. #ba1131 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2262 with #750000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

Shades and Tints of #ba1131
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060102 is the darkest color, while #fef3f5 is the lightest one.
